4. Secure Necessary Startup Capital:
Determine the required capital for starting your sandwiches restaurant, including expenses for location, renovations, equipment, permits, licenses, supplies, and initial marketing. Explore options for funding, such as personal savings, loans, or potential investors.

6. Hire and Manage Employees:
Recruit a qualified team with the required skills and experience. Train your employees on food safety, customer service, and operational processes. Develop an efficient schedule, delegate tasks, and provide regular feedback to maximize productivity and efficiency.

11. Purchase Necessary Production Equipment:
Invest in highquality and appropriate equipment to ensure smooth operations and consistent food quality. This includes refrigeration, grills, toasters, food processors, and other essential tools. Regularly maintain and service equipment to minimize downtime.
